WHAT YOU'LL DO:
  • Develop and deliver production-quality agentic AI systems end-to-end using Python, Go, and/or Java, covering EKS deployment, agent runtimes, memory systems, orchestration, tool integration, and evaluation pipelines that operate across Ripple's polyrepo engineering environment.
  • Define and advance Ripple's Enterprise Agentic AI and developer platform architecture through practical implementations, reference systems, and production deployments - not abstract diagrams.
  • Build and implement multi-agent orchestration patterns (planner, executor, reviewer, tool agents) using frameworks such as LangGraph, MCP, Claude Code agent harnesses, or similar orchestration systems, with strong regression coverage and observability.
  • Run fast, high-quality POCs on emerging agent architectures; harden successful patterns into reusable platform services, APIs, SDKs, and developer templates that engineering teams across Ripple can adopt.
  • Architect and implement data flywheels that continuously improve agent quality through telemetry, benchmarking, automated evaluation, and structured feedback loops - treating quality, cost, latency, and safety as first-class signals.
  • Embed security, guardrails, sandbox isolation, auditability, and policy enforcement directly into agent runtimes in partnership with security, compliance, and governance teams - particularly for workflows that touch XRPL, RLUSD, and payment systems.
  • Evaluate, integrate, and extend open-source and third-party agent platforms; drive disciplined build-vs-use decisions based on performance, scalability, control, and long-term platform ownership.
  • Collaborate closely with engineering, infrastructure, product, and business partners to align architectural direction with enterprise priorities and accelerate adoption across the organization.


WHAT YOU'LL BRING:
  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or related field or equivalent experience; Master's or PhD preferred.
  • 10+ years of experience building and shipping large-scale distributed systems with significant hands-on coding in Python, Go, Java, or similar systems languages.
  • Proven ability to move quickly from idea to functional prototype to robust, scalable platform solution.
  • Proven track record in constructing agentic AI systems, including RAG pipelines, long-lived memory models, multi-agent orchestration (e.g., AgentCore, Strands, LangGraph, MCP, Claude Code, LangChain), tool frameworks, and evaluation infrastructure.
  • Expert-level depth in Kubernetes (EKS preferred), service mesh (Istio), containerized workloads, networking, APIs, and secure enterprise integration patterns.
  • Experience crafting benchmarking, regression testing, telemetry, and observability systems (OpenTelemetry, Prometheus, Grafana) that measure agent quality, latency, cost, reliability, and safety.
  • Strong understanding of performance tuning in hybrid environments, including managed inference endpoints and GPU-based workloads.
  • Excellent collaboration skills with the ability to influence cross-functional partners, build positive relationships, and clearly communicate complex architectural concepts to both technical and business audiences.

About Ripple

Ripple is a technology company that provides solutions for global payments. The company's main product is the Ripple payment protocol and its associated digital currency XRP. Ripple's payment protocol is designed to enable secure, instantly and nearly free global financial transactions of any size with no chargebacks. Ripple's customers include banks, payment providers, digital asset exchanges and corporates. The company was founded in 2012 and is headquartered in San Francisco, California.
